Many workplace retirement plans allow you to take out a loan of up to $50,000 (or 50 percent of your assets, whichever is less) against 401 (k) savings. You’ll owe interest, but no taxes or penalties provided you pay the money back. WebWhen you borrow money against your home, it means the loan is secured by it. So, if you can’t afford your repayments you may be forced to sell your property to cover what you owe.
